• 제목/요약/키워드: off-line algorithms

검색결과 79건 처리시간 0.022초

통행시간 패턴인식형 버스도착시간 예측 알고리즘 개발 연구 (A Study on Development of Bus Arrival Time Prediction Algorithm by using Travel Time Pattern Recognition)

  • 장현호;윤병조;이진수
    • 대한토목학회논문집
    • /
    • 제39권6호
    • /
    • pp.833-839
    • /
    • 2019
  • BIS (Bus Information System:버스정보시스템, 이하 BIS)는 시내버스 운행과 관련된 각종 정보를 수집하고 예측알고리즘을 통해 이용객에게 정보를 제공하고 있다. 동일 구간의 최근 정보를 통한 예측방법은 해당 구간의 소통상황을 반영하지만 예측 대상노선의 특성을 반영할 수 없다는 한계가 있다. 해당노선의 동시간대 과거이력자료를 통해 예측하는 방법은 소통상황의 변동성이 큰 첨두시 예측에 한계가 있는 실정이다. 따라서 예측대상 시점의 통행패턴을 인식하고 가장 유사한 과거 시점의 통행패턴을 선택할 수 있는 패턴인식형 버스도착시간 예측 알고리즘을 개발하였다. 본연구의 예측 결과를 서울시 BIS 도착예측정보이력과 비교 검증한 결과 각 정류장 간 통행시간의 평균제곱근오차가 비첨두시 약 35초(기존: 40초), 첨두시 약 40초(기존: 60초)로 기존대비 약 10~20 %의 개선을 보였다. 이는 동일 과거 시간대 외의 시간대에 현재 교통상황을 대표할 수 있는 자료가 존재함을 의미한다.

이관성계 전동기 구동시스템의 축진동억제를 위한 강인한 속도제어기법 (Robust Speed Control Scheme for Torsional Vibration Suppression of Two Mass System)

  • 박태식;유지윤
    • 전력전자학회논문지
    • /
    • 제8권1호
    • /
    • pp.80-88
    • /
    • 2003
  • 본 논문에서는 Kharitonov의 강인 안정도 이론을 적용한 이관성계 전동기 구동시스템에 대한 새로운 축진동억제 제어방식을 제안한다. 제안한 축진동억제 제어기는 전동기 속도와 관측된 비틀림 토크를 궤환하는 축소차원 상태궤환 제어기와 PI 제어기를 이용한 속도제어기로 구성되어 있다. 또한 오프라인 RLS 방식으로 추정된 기계계 파라미터를 사용하여 축진동 억제를 위한 속도제어기를 설계하고, Kharitonov의 강인 안정도 이론을 적용하여 제어기의 이득을 선정하였다. Kharitonov의 강인안정도 이론을 통해 지정한 안정도 마진과 댐펑 특성을 확보하였으며 지정된 범위 내에서 파라미터가 변동시에도 우수한 축진동 억제 특성을 획득하였다. 마지막으로 시뮬레이션과 자체 제작한 이관성계 전동기 구동 시스템의 통가 실험장치를 통해 축진동억제 제어방식의 효과와 유용성을 검증하였다.

휴대용 내장형 시스템에서 DC-DC 변환기를 고려한 동적 전압 조절 (DVS) 기법 (Dynamic Voltage Scaling (DVS) Considering the DC-DC Converter in Portable Embedded Systems)

  • 최용석;장래혁;김태환
    • 대한전자공학회논문지SD
    • /
    • 제44권2호
    • /
    • pp.95-103
    • /
    • 2007
  • 동적 전압 조절(Dynamic voltage scaling, DVS) 기법은 가장 효과적이면서 가장 잘 알려진 전력 관리 기법 중 하나이다. DVS가 효율적인 여유 시간(Slack time) 분배 방법, 전압 할당 방법 등 다양한 방면에서 연구되었지만, 전압 변경 가능 프로세서 이외의 장치들에 대한 영향은 제대로 연구되지 못했다. DC-DC 변환기는 오늘날 대부분의 내장형 시스템에서 내부 장치들을 위한 다양한 값의 공급 전압 생성 및 전압 안정화 기능을 제공하는 중요한 역할을 하고 있으며, 특히 공급 전압의 계속적인 변경이 필요한 DVS를 적용하기 위해서는 필수적인 구성 요소이다. 이 논문에서는 DC-DC 변환기의 전력 소모를 포함한 시스템의 에너지 소모에 대해 분석하고 이를 바탕으로 DC-DC 변환기를 포함하는 시스템 또는 이와 유사한 형태의 에너지 소모 특성을 가지는 시스템에서 에너지 소모를 최소화하는 새로운 에너지 최적 오프라인 DVS 스케줄링 알고리즘을 제안하고, 실험 결과를 통해 제안된 알고리즘이 어떤 종류의 설정에서도 기존의 DVS 알고리즘보다 더 적은 에너지 소모의 스케줄을 생성함을 보여준다.

모션 면적을 이용한 버추얼 카메라의 자동 제어 기법 (Automatic Virtual Camera Control Using Motion Area)

  • 권지용;이인권
    • 한국컴퓨터그래픽스학회논문지
    • /
    • 제14권2호
    • /
    • pp.9-17
    • /
    • 2008
  • 본 논문에서는 캐릭터의 의견을 고려한 카메라의 파라미터를 결정하는 방법을 제안한다. 기본적인 아이디어는 캐릭터의 각각의 링크가 화면상의 평면에 투영되었을 때의 움직임을 면적으로 계산하여 이를 활용하는 것이다. 우리는 이러한 면적을 '모션 면적'이라고 정의하였다. 모션 면적을 이용하면 실시간 혹은 오프라인 상에서 캐릭터의 모션에 대한 적절한 카메라 경로 혹은 고정된 카메라의 위치를 결정할 수 있다. 우리는 실험을 통해서 제안하는 방법으로 만들어진 카메라 경로가 부드럽게 움직임과 동시에 캐릭터의 모션을 보다 역동적으로 보이게끔 한다는 사실을 관측하였다. 또한 제안하는 방법은 카메라의 시선이 장애물과 충돌하지 않도록 하는 제어 기법과 쉽게 합쳐져서 사용될 수 있다. 우리는 또한 제안하는 방법이 역동적으로 움직이는 캐릭터를 포함하는 장면에서의 시각적 품질을 측정하늘 도구로써 다른 일반적인 카메라 제어 기법과 함께 쓰일 수 있을 것으로 기대한다.

  • PDF

조선소 병렬 기계 공정에서의 납기 지연 및 셋업 변경 최소화를 위한 강화학습 기반의 생산라인 투입순서 결정 (Reinforcement Learning for Minimizing Tardiness and Set-Up Change in Parallel Machine Scheduling Problems for Profile Shops in Shipyard)

  • 남소현;조영인;우종훈
    • 대한조선학회논문집
    • /
    • 제60권3호
    • /
    • pp.202-211
    • /
    • 2023
  • The profile shops in shipyards produce section steels required for block production of ships. Due to the limitations of shipyard's production capacity, a considerable amount of work is already outsourced. In addition, the need to improve the productivity of the profile shops is growing because the production volume is expected to increase due to the recent boom in the shipbuilding industry. In this study, a scheduling optimization was conducted for a parallel welding line of the profile process, with the aim of minimizing tardiness and the number of set-up changes as objective functions to achieve productivity improvements. In particular, this study applied a dynamic scheduling method to determine the job sequence considering variability of processing time. A Markov decision process model was proposed for the job sequence problem, considering the trade-off relationship between two objective functions. Deep reinforcement learning was also used to learn the optimal scheduling policy. The developed algorithm was evaluated by comparing its performance with priority rules (SSPT, ATCS, MDD, COVERT rule) in test scenarios constructed by the sampling data. As a result, the proposed scheduling algorithms outperformed than the priority rules in terms of set-up ratio, tardiness, and makespan.

양극성 자기유도센서의 성능 향상을 위한 퍼지 추론 시스템 (Improvement of Bipolar Magnetic Guidance Sensor Performance using Fuzzy Inference System)

  • 박문호;조현학;김광백;김성신
    • 한국지능시스템학회논문지
    • /
    • 제24권1호
    • /
    • pp.58-63
    • /
    • 2014
  • 자기테이프를 사용하는 대부분의 경량무인운반차들(AGCs)은 디지털 자기유도센서를 사용한다. 디지털 자기유도센서는 On/Off 타입으로 자기테이프의 위치측정 정밀도가 10~50 mm의 오차를 가진다. 또한 경량무인운반차에 설치된 모터의 자기장이나 주변 환경의 외부 자기장, 지자기 등으로 인하여 정확한 위치를 추정하기 힘들다. 이러한 오차로 인하여 경량무인운반차의 주행 시에 잦은 흔들림이 발생하게 되고, 정도가 심할 경우 이탈현상이 발생하게 된다. 따라서 본 논문은 양극성 아날로그 자기유도센서에 퍼지 추론 시스템의 적용을 제안한다. 퍼지는 다른 알고리즘에 비하여 내고장성과 불확실성에 강인하고, 실시간 작동에 유리하며, 비선형시스템에 사용하기 적합하다. 선행과제에서 제작한 양극성 아날로그 자기유도센서로 threshold를 두어 디지털 자기유도센서를 형성하고, 이를 이용하여 자석위치 값을 계산한다. On으로 인식된 아날로그 Hall sensor의 출력을 이용하여 퍼지 추론 시스템을 설계하고, 그 출력으로 디지털출력 값을 개선한다. 실험 결과, 제안된 방법이 기존의 자기유도센서보다 성능이 향상된 것을 확인하였다.

0/1 제약조건을 갖는 부정확한 태스크들의 총오류를 최소화시키기 위한 개선된 온라인 알고리즘 (An Improved Online Algorithm to Minimize Total Error of the Imprecise Tasks with 0/1 Constraint)

  • 송기현
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제34권10호
    • /
    • pp.493-501
    • /
    • 2007
  • 부정확한 실시간시스템은 시간적으로 긴급한 태스크들을 융통성있게 스케줄링해줄 수 있다. 총 오류를 최소화시키면서 0/1제약조건과 시간적 제약조건들을 모두 만족시키는 대부분의 스케줄링문제들은 선택적 태스크들이 임의의 수행시간을 갖고 있을 때 NP-complete이다. Liu는 단일처리기상에서 0/1제약조건을 갖는 태스크들을 총 오류가 최소화되도록 스케줄링시킬 수 있는 합리적인 전략을 제시하였다. 또한, 송 등은 다중처리기상에서 0/1제약조건을 갖는 태스크들을 총 오류가 최소화되도록 스케줄링시킬 수 있는 합리적인 전략을 제시하였다. 그러나, 이러한 알고리즘들은 모두 오프라인 알고리즘들이다. 그런데, 온라인 스케줄링에 있어서, NORA알고리즘은 부정확한 온라인 태스크 시스템상에서 최소의 총 오류를 갖는 스케줄을 찾을 수 있다. 이러한 NORA알고리즘에 있어서, EDF전략이 선택적 스케줄링에 적용되었다. 한편, 0/1 제약조건을 갖는 태스크시스템에 있어서는, EDF스케줄링이 총 오류가 최소화된다는 측면에서 최적이 아닐수도 있다 더욱이, 선택적 태스크들이 그들의 실행요구시간의 오름차순으로 스케쥴될 때, EBF전략이 적용된 NORA알고리즘이 최소의 총오류를 산출할 수 없을지도 모른다. 그러므로, 본 논문에서는, 0/1제약조건을 갖는 부정확한 태스크 시스템의 총 오류를 최소화시키는 온라인 알고리즘이 제안되었다. 그리고나서, 제시된 알고리즘과 NORA 알고리즘 사이의 성능을 비교하기 위하여 여러 가지 실험들이 수행되었다. 두 알고리즘들 사이의 성능비교의 결과로서, 선택적 태스크들이 그들의 실행요구시간들의 임의의 순서대로 스케줄 될 때는 제안된 알고리즘이 NORA알고리즘과 비슷한 총 오류를 산출하지만 특별히 선택적 태스크들이 그들의 실행요구시간들의 오름차순으로 스케줄 될 때는 제안된 알고리즘이 NORA알고리즘보다 더 적은 총 오류를 산출할 수 있음이 밝혀졌다. 프라이버시 문제를 해결하도록 방안을 제시한다. 구간 보안 역시 완전한 솔루션을 제시하고 있지는 않다. 본 논문에서는 이러한 취약성을 고찰하고 그에 따른 대응방안을 제시하였다.긴 경우가 1예 있었으며, 수술 후 30일내 사망한 예가 1예였고 다른 1예는 전이성 암으로 사망하였다. 걸론: 근치적 방법으로 치료가 힘든 경우의 만성 농흉 환자들에게 있어 개방식 배농술과 근육이식술, 근육피판을 이용한 최종적인 개방창 폐쇄술까지의 단계적인 접근 방법이 안전하고 효과적인 대안이 될 수 있을 것으로 생각한다.만으로 야뇨횟수에 호전을 보이는 초기반응군 경우 2개월째 투약반응이 유의하게 좋았다. 이로써 야뇨증의 치료초기 행동요법에 대한 반응정도는 치료효과를 예측하는 지표로서 활용될 수 있다고 판단된다.지침을 제공할 수 있다. 소아의 첫 요로감염시 초음파나 $^{99m}Tc$-DMSA 신장 스캔상에서 양성소견이 있을 경우 배뇨성 방광 요도 조영술 검사를 시행하는 것이 좋으며, 초음파와 $^{99m}Tc$-DMSA 신장 스캔상에서 양성소견이 없을 경우라도 CRP 또는 백혈구 등의 임상자료들을 평가하여 배뇨성 방광 요도 조영술 검사를 시행유무를 결정하는 것이 잔존하는 방광요관역류를 찾는데 도움이 될 것으로 생각된다.O$로 고칼슘뇨군에서 더 농축된 소변을 보았다(P=0.003). 결론 :고칼슘뇨군의 소변화학검사의 가장 특징적인 소견은 요소 배설과 사구체여과율의 증가로서 이는 고칼슘뇨군이 비고칼슘뇨군에 비하여 고단백식이를 하고 있을 가능성을 시사한다. 나트륨과 칼슘은 사구체 여과가 증가함에 따라 원위세뇨관 및 집합관에 도달하는 양도 증가하고 그 곳에서 나트륨의 재흡수 기전이 매우 정교하게 이루어지는데 비하여 칼슘의 그 것은 그렇지 못하여 고칼슘뇨증을 일으켰을 가능성이 있다. 향후 고칼슘뇨 환아를 진료함에 있어서 단백질 섭취 등식이

광역조건식에 의한 공유자원 접근오류 검색 (Detecting Shared Resource Usage Errors with Global Predicates)

  • 이은정;윤기중
    • 한국정보과학회논문지:소프트웨어및응용
    • /
    • 제26권12호
    • /
    • pp.1445-1454
    • /
    • 1999
  • 광역 조건식의 계산은 분산 프로그램의 수행을 테스트 또는 디버깅하기 위한 방법으로 활 발히 연구되고 있다. 이제까지 주로 연구된 광역조건식은 AND 또는 OR 광역 조건식 등이 있는데, 특히 AND 광역 조건식은 분산 프로그램의 동시적 조건을 표현하는데 유용하여 효율적인 검색 알고리즘이 활발히 연구되었다. 분산프로그램의 수행오류로서 공유자원의 배타적 접근조건은 가장 중요하고 일반적인 경우라 할 수 있다. 본 논문에서는 XOR 연산을 이용하여 공유자원 프로그램의 오류 검색을 위한 광역조건식을 기술하는 방식에 대해 제안하였다. XOR 연산을 이용한 광역 조건식은 연산자 중 많아야 하나의 지역조건식만이 참일 때 전체 조건식이 참이 되는데 이러한 성질은 여러 프로세스 중 한번에 하나만이 공유자원에 배타적으로 접근할 수 있는 조건을 표현하는데 매우 유용하다. n 개의 프로세스로 이루어진 분산프로그램에서 한개의 공유자원에 대한 배타적 접근 조건을 기술하기 위해서 AND로 연결된 광역조건식을 이용하면 O(n2)개의 광역 조건식이 필요한데 반해 XOR 연산으로는 하나의 조건식으로 나타낼 수 있다. 더구나 XOR 연산을 이용한 광역조건식은 최근 소개된 겹치는 구간의 개념을 활용하면 매우 간단하게 검색할 수 있다. 본 논문에서는 겹치는 구간을 찾는 검색 알고리즘을 소개하고 증명하였다.Abstract Detecting global predicates is an useful tool for debugging and testing a distributed program. Past research has considered several restricted forms of predicates, including conjunctive or disjunctive form of predicates. Especially, conjunctive predicates have attracted main attention not only because they are useful to describe simultaneous conditions in a distributed program, but also because it is possible to find algorithms to evaluate them within reasonable time bound. Detecting errors in accessing shared resources are the most popular and important constraints of distributed programs. In this paper, we introduced an exclusive OR predicates as a model of global predicates to describe shared resource conditions in distributed programs. An exclusive OR predicate holds only when at most one operand is true, which is useful to describe mutual exclusion conditions of distributed programs where only one process should be allowed to access the shared resource at a time. One exclusive OR predicate is enough to describe mutual exclusion condition of n processes with one shared resource, while it takes O(n2) conjunctive predicates. Moreover, exclusive OR condition is easily detectable using the concept of overlapping intervals introduced by Venkatesan and Dathan. An off-line algorithm for evaluating exclusive OR global predicates is presented with a correctness proof.

합성 PC부재에 의한 그린 프레임의 철근물량 산출 자동화 알고리즘 (Automatic Algorithms of Rebar Quantity Take-Off of Green Frame by Composite Precast Concrete Members)

  • 이성호;김선형;이군재;김선국;주진규
    • 한국건설관리학회논문집
    • /
    • 제13권1호
    • /
    • pp.118-128
    • /
    • 2012
  • 1980년대 이후 국내 아파트에서 적용되어온 벽식구조는 리모델링 시 많은 문제점을 유발시켜 정부에서는 법적 인센티브를 제공하며 무량판 및 라멘구조를 장려하고 있다. 이에 따라 기존의 골조의 문제점을 개선한 친환경 라멘조인 그린 프레임이 개발되어 구조적 안전성 뿐 아니라 시공성, 친환경성에 대한 검증이 이루어졌다. 그린프레임의 경우 설계단계에서 작성된 프리캐스트 콘크리트(Precast Concrete; PC) 부재 정보를 이용하여 물량 산출 및 철근 가공도(bar bending schedule) 등을 자동으로 작성하면 인력저감 뿐 아니라 철근 손율(loss)을 줄이는 철근조합을 용이하게 수행할 수 있다. 따라서 본 연구는 합성 PC부재에 의해 설계된 그린 프레임의 철근물량 산출 자동화 알고리즘을 개발하는 것을 목적으로 한다. 철근물량 산출자동화 알고리즘은 구조 설계정보, 시방정보, 합성PC의 철골정보 등을 이용하여 작성한 후 사례현장 적용을 통하여 개발된 알고리즘의 효용성을 증명한다. 개발된 알고리즘에 의해 저장된 정보는 철근가공조립도, 철근 재단 리스트(bar cutting list)작성 자동화 뿐 아니라 철근 손율을 최소화 할 수 있는 최적조합과 주문물량 산출 자동화에도 활용될 것이다. 또한 공사관리인력 저감 뿐 아니라 철근 손율 최소화 관리에 따른 공사 원가절감의 효과를 기대할 수 있다.